﻿@charset "utf-8";
body{ padding:0px; margin:0px auto; font-size:12px; color:#666; background: url(../images/subsationbg.jpg) no-repeat center top #c6e6fb; font-family:"宋体";width: 100%; min-width:1000px; width:expression((documentElement.clientWidth < 1000) ? "1000px" : "100%" );zoom:1; }
table{ border:0px; border-collapse:collapse;}
li{ list-style:none;}
ul,li,form, dl,dt, dd, div ,ol{ padding: 0px; margin: 0px; }
select,input{ font-size:12px; font-style:normal;}
img{ border:none; border:0;}
a{ text-decoration:none;noline: expression(this.onFocus=this.blur());color:#666;}
a:focus {outline:none;-moz-outline:none;}
a:hover{ color:#f96f29; text-decoration:none;}
.clear{ clear:both; height:0px; overflow:hidden;}
/*top.html*/
.info{ overflow-x:hidden; text-align:justify; word-wrap: break-word; word-break: normal; line-height:22px;}



.Contain{ background:url(../images/bottombg.jpg) no-repeat center bottom; padding-bottom:97px; height:auto !important; height:700px; min-height:700px;}
.Content{ width:1002px; margin:0 auto; background:url(../images/subsation_mainbg.png) repeat-y center top; overflow:hidden;}
.Content_b{ width:1002px; margin:0 auto;background:url(../images/subsation_main_b.png) no-repeat 1px top; height:23px; line-height:23px; overflow:hidden;}
.Header{ height:400px;}
.top_area{ width:980px; margin:0 auto; position:relative; padding-top:9px;}
.Ban{ height:267px; background:#fff;}
.Ban img{ width:980px; height:267px;}
.top_head{ background:url(../images/sub_topbg.jpg) repeat-x left top; height:75px; position:relative;}
.top_head a.logo{ width:221px; display:block; height:75px; position:absolute; left:20px; top:0px; background:url(../images/sub_logo.jpg) no-repeat;}

.back_home{ background:url(../images/set.jpg) no-repeat; width:179px; height:24px; position:absolute; right:9px; top:0px; overflow:hidden;}
.back_home a{ width:89px; display:block; float:left; height:24px;}

.Current{ height:40px; line-height:40px; padding-top:35px; text-align:right; padding-right:5px;}
.Current em{ background:url(../images/sub_ico_home.png) no-repeat left 10px; padding-left:24px; font-style:normal; display:inline-block; color:#888;}
.Current em a{color:#888;}
.Current em span{ color:#4799cc;}

.Menu{ height:50px; background:url(../images/mainnav_bg.png) no-repeat left top; text-align:center; }
.Menu em{ font-style:normal; display:inline-block;height:50px;  background:url(../images/mainnav_line.jpg) no-repeat right 15px;padding:0 6px;}
.Menu em.end{ background:none;}
.Menu em a{ line-height:40px; width:120px; text-align:center; font-size:16px; font-family:微软雅黑; display:inline-block; color:#fff;}
.Menu em a:hover,.Menu em a.aon{ background:url(../images/mainnav_aon.jpg) no-repeat center 5px; color:#d35e03;}

.Main{ padding-top:14px; padding-left:12px; padding-right:17px;}
.page_Main{ padding-top:14px; padding-left:50px; padding-right:50px; height:auto !important; height:300px; min-height:300px;}
.main_left{ width:680px; float:left;}
.main_right{ width:285px; float:right;}

.Footer{ width:908px; margin:0 auto; height:auto !important; height:140px; min-height:140px; text-align:center; line-height:25px; color:#666;}
.other_column{ color:#f96f29;padding-top:20px;}
.other_column a{color:#f96f29; padding:0 5px;}
.other_column a:hover{ text-decoration:underline;}

.bottom_link a{padding:0 5px;color:#666;}
.bottom_link a:hover{color:#f96f29; }
.copyright{  font-family:Arial, Helvetica, sans-serif;}
.copyright span{ font-size:11px; margin-left:15px;}

.mark a{ display:inline-block; padding-left:20px; background-image:url(../images/icon_sina_qq_wx.png); background-repeat: no-repeat; padding-right:15px;}
.mark a.sina{ background-position:0 0; padding-left:25px;}
.mark a.qq{ background-position:-90px 0;}
.mark a.wx{ background-position:-160px 0; padding-left:30px;}


#AdLayer {position: fixed;bottom: 400px;right: 10px;background:url(../images/gettop.png) no-repeat; width:28px; height:37px; display: none; cursor:pointer;}

.active_intro{ padding-bottom:20px; overflow:hidden;}
.active_intro .title{ background:url(../images/sub_title_huodongjieshao.png) no-repeat; height:55px; overflow:hidden;}
.active_intro .title a{ float:right; display:block; width:107px; height:55px; margin-right:11px;}
.active_intro .intro{ padding-top:22px; padding-left:8px; padding-right:18px;}
.active_intro .intro img{ float:left; border:1px solid #d9d9d9; padding:6px; background:#fff; width:262px; height:178px; margin-right:30px;}
.active_intro .intro p{ text-indent:25px; margin:0; line-height:22px; padding-top:5px; text-align:justify; text-justify:inter-ideograph;}

.News .title{ background:url(../images/sub_title_qiydongtai.png) no-repeat; height:41px; overflow:hidden;}
.News .title a{ float:right; display:block; width:64px; height:41px;}

.News li{ height:106px; position:relative; padding-left:164px; padding-top:14px; padding-right:24px;}
.News li .picture{ position:absolute; width:120px; height:81px; padding:4px; border:1px solid #d9d9d9; top:14px; left:12px;background:#fff;}
.News li .picture img{width:120px; height:81px;}
.News li h5{ height:28px; line-height:28px; font-size:14px; margin:0;}
.News li h5 span{float:right; font-size:12px; font-weight:normal;}
.News li h5 span a{ color:#ff4200; }
.News li p{ margin:0; padding-top:5px; line-height:20px;}

a.fill_table{ background:url(../images/sub_btn_atvice.png) no-repeat; height:109px; display:block; margin-bottom:10px;}
.Contact{ border:1px solid #d9d9d9; overflow:hidden; background:#fff; padding-bottom:80px;}
.Contact .title{ border-top:3px solid #aad01c; height:64px; background:url(../images/sub_title_lianxifangshi.jpg) no-repeat center bottom;}
.Contact .con{ padding:0 18px;} 
.Contact .con p{ margin:0; line-height:20px; padding-top:5px; padding-bottom:20px;}
.Contact .con a.view{ background:url(../images/sub_more.jpg) no-repeat; width:103px; height:28px; display:inline-block;}

/*pages*/
.Pages{ padding:10px 0; line-height:18px; zoom:1; overflow:hidden; border-top:1px solid #d9d9d9; margin-top:10px; text-align:right;}
.Pages span{ padding:0px 3px; display:inline-block;}
.Pages a{ display:inline-block; margin:0px 2px;}
.Pages .p_cur b{ color:#ff4200;}
.Pages .p_count b{ color:#ff4200;}
.Pages  b{ font-weight:normal;}
.Pages .i_text{ width:30px; padding:0px; text-align:center; font-size:12px; border:inset 1px #ddd; background:#fff;}
.Pages .i_button { position:relative; top:0px; width:32px; height:20px; cursor:pointer; border:none; background:url(../images/page_goto.jpg) no-repeat; vertical-align:middle;}
/*pages end*/
.newsInfo{ height:auto !important; height:400px; min-height:400px;}
.newsInfo .Title{ font-size:16px; font-weight:bold; padding:5px 0; line-height:20px; text-align:center;font-family:"微软雅黑"; color:#f96f29; }
.createInfo{ text-align:center; padding:10px 0; color:#ccc;}
.info_prevnext{ line-height:30px; /*display:none;*/ }
.info_prevnext span{ display:block;}
.info_back{ text-align:center; padding:20px 0;/* font-weight:bold; display:none; */}
.info_back a{ color:#fff; background:#f96f29; display:inline-block; padding:0px 15px; height:27px; line-height:27px;}

/*Start*/
.templet_message_002 { line-height:20px; color:#888888;}
.templet_message_002 ul li h5{ font-size:12px; line-height:30px; color:#777777; padding-left:31px; display:block; font-weight:normal; cursor:pointer; background:url(../images/templet_message_iconQ.jpg) no-repeat left top #fff; border-top:solid 1px #e2e2e2; margin:0;}
.templet_message_002 ul li h5 span{ float:right; padding-right:20px;}
.templet_message_002 ul li .my_content{ line-height:20px; color:#0d79bd; background:url(../images/templet_message_iconA.jpg) no-repeat left top #fafafa; border-top:solid 1px #e2e2e2; padding:10px 31px;}

.templet_message_002 table{ margin-bottom:20px; background:#fff; margin-top:-9px;}
.templet_message_002 table td{ border-bottom:solid 1px #e2e2e2; border-collapse:collapse; padding:4px 7px;}
.templet_message_002 table .end td{ border:none;}
.templet_message_002 h3{ background: url(../images/templet_message_titlebg1.jpg) repeat-x 0 0; padding:0px 12px; font-size:12px; line-height:27px; color:#fff;height:30px;  margin:0 0 8px 0;}
.templet_message_002 h3 em{ font-style:normal; padding-left:200px;}
.templet_message_002 h3 span{ float:right; border-left:solid 1px #ffffff; line-height:11px;*line-height:15px; padding:0px 20px 0px 46px; margin-top:8px;* margin-top:6px;}
.templet_message_002 h4{  margin:0 0 8px 0;background:  url(../images/templet_message_titlebg1.jpg) repeat-x 0 0; padding:0px 12px; font-size:12px; line-height:27px; color:#fff;}

.templet_message_002 .btnBox{border-top:solid 1px #da7209; padding:16px 0px; height:40px;}
.templet_message_002 .btnBox .tips{ float:left;}
.templet_message_002 .btnBox .tips span{ color:#da7209;}
.templet_message_002 .btn{ background:#da7209; width:51px; height:27px; color:#fff; border:none; cursor:pointer; float:right; margin-left:10px;}
.templet_message_002 .text{ width:170px; height:21px; line-height:21px; padding:0px 5px; border:solid 1px #8fcc0d; background:url(../images/templet_message_textbg.jpg) repeat-x top;}
.templet_message_002 textarea{  height:160px; line-height:21px; padding:0px 5px; border:solid 1px #8fcc0d; background:url(../images/templet_message_textbg.jpg) repeat-x top #fff;}
.templet_message_002 .required{ color:#F00;}

.templet_message_002 .Pages{ border-top:0px;}
/*End*/

